Breathing toxic fumes

The expensive and toxic alternatives families use to escape the darkness can have devastating effects on their health. Using a kerosene lamp or a crude oil candle releases thick, toxic smoke into a family’s home each year causing eye strains, chest infections, and leading to more serious illness. 

The World Health Organisation (WHO) estimates that 4 million people per year die prematurely from illnesses attributable to household air pollution. This is more deaths per year than HIV, malaria and tuberculosis combined.

Toxic lighting sources cause a preventable strain on already fragile healthcare systems, which themselves are often reliant on kerosene, candles or diesel in order to operate.
